Output 95c63f332482e933bfb9a2802906932805b5b0bcfdfdd467897291b1571e8056:0

value
7093383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5a813fb6e39b5fd9a0e8112a86c34c82015621 OP_EQUAL
address
3D2Y8ii5RK4e5tEuHdSzAPazxmUeJqymYa
transaction
95c63f332482e933bfb9a2802906932805b5b0bcfdfdd467897291b1571e8056
spent
true